Mule
The Mule is a cube van that is on all of the GTA III era games (except GTA Advance), as well as Grand Theft Auto IV. It has no special purpose and only serves as another vehicle to drive. Two people can fit in the cab of the truck; the rear part does not open. The rear part cannot be accessed unless the truck is seriously damaged, then the rear of the truck is exposed - the truck will contain various items of cargo in GTA Vice City, GTA San Andreas, and GTA Vice City Stories. Due to the truck's awkward weight division, it can flip over easily. The Mule most closely resembles a 1989 or 1990 Ford E350 cube van. In GTA IV, it resembles a Mitsubishi FH100, with headlights similar to a previous generation Isuzu Elf. Unlike all other GTA versions of the Mule, it won't flip over, but is still slow. The GTA IV Mule is manufactured by Maibatsu.
